The Scene
Originally a Schlitz house built in 1922, Southport Lanes is a bar and grill with four bowling alleys (where pin boys still do the setting) and a billiard room with six sleek, regulation-size tables. Original stained-glass windows grace the main bar and its high-backed wood booths and tables. On weekends, the crowds of preppy singles in their 20s and early 30s extend out the door, several layers of people crowding the bar shouting for another drink, or having a hollered conversation over the too-loud music.
The Draw
A jukebox is stocked with Dave Matthews Band, the Grateful Dead and whatever else the kids are listening to these days. The full bar can handle mainstream cocktails, but draft and bottled beer are most popular. Straightforward American food is served in huge portions--including cheddar fries and delicious turkey and chicken Caesar sandwiches.
